fbpx

Основы HTML и CSS для стартующих

Основы HTML и CSS для стартующих

Разработка веб-страниц берёт начало с постижения двух основных инструментов. HTML отвечает за архитектуру и наполнение веб-страниц. CSS управляет визуальным оформлением блоков.

Программисты используют HTML для размещения текста, графики, гиперссылок и других компонентов. CSS позволяет устанавливать цвета, гарнитуры, размеры и размещение элементов. Эти языки функционируют совместно и дополняют друг друга.

Изучение казино вулкан официальный сайт предоставляет дорогу к специальности веб-разработчика. Понимание базовых основ позволяет строить действующие и приятные сайты. Новички профессионалы могут оперативно получить практические умения и использовать их в действующих проектах.

Что такое HTML и зачем он необходим веб-ресурсу

HTML расшифровывается как HyperText Markup Language. Язык разметки задаёт структуру веб-документов и структурирует наполнение веб-страниц. Браузеры интерпретируют HTML-код и представляют информацию в доступном для пользователей виде.

Каждый блок веб-страницы описывается специальными директивами. Заголовки, абзацы, перечни, таблицы и формы формируются с помощью тегов. Метки являются собой директивы, размещённые в угловые скобки. Браузер обрабатывает эти директивы и формирует графическое отображение содержимого.

Без HTML невозможно построить Вулкан казино любого типа. Язык разметки выступает базой для всех интернет-ресурсов. Поисковые движки анализируют HTML-структуру для каталогизации страниц. Верная структура повышает позиции портала в итогах запроса.

HTML регулярно развивается и обретает новые возможности. Новейшая версия HTML5 обеспечивает видео, аудио и интерактивные элементы. Разработчики могут интегрировать медийный содержимое без дополнительных плагинов. Смысловые метки способствуют Вулкан лучше распознавать роль разных элементов страницы.

Главные метки и построение веб-страницы

Любой HTML-документ имеет чёткую многоуровневую архитектуру. Основной элемент html содержит всё наполнение страницы. Внутри находятся два ключевых блока: head и body.

Секция head содержит служебную информацию о файле. Здесь задаётся титул веб-страницы, подключаются стили и скрипты. Пользователи не видят контент этого раздела напрямую. Секция body включает весь отображаемый контент.

Для структурирования контента задействуются различные метки:

  • h1-h6 генерируют заголовки разнообразных уровней
  • p формирует текстовые параграфы
  • a генерирует линки на иные веб-страницы
  • img вставляет картинки в страницу
  • ul и ol генерируют маркерные и нумерованные перечни
  • table организует информацию в табличном виде

Семантические теги создают структуру более ясной. Тег header определяет верхнюю часть веб-ресурса. Элемент nav собирает навигационные гиперссылки. Раздел main включает центральное контент веб-страницы. Footer размещается в нижней секции и включает контактную информацию.

Правильная структура страницы существенна для доступности. Утилиты чтения с экрана задействуют казино Вулкан для перемещения по сайту. Последовательная компоновка компонентов облегчает усвоение данных всеми категориями посетителей. Правильный скрипт работает корректно во всех современных браузерах.

Как CSS отвечает за визуальный вид веб-ресурса

CSS интерпретируется как Cascading Style Sheets. Каскадные таблицы стилей задают визуальное представление HTML-элементов. Инструмент разделяет стилизацию от архитектуры страницы.

Без стилей все веб-страницы отображаются однообразно. Браузер показывает текст чёрным цветом на белом фоновом цвете. Названия имеют типовые размеры. CSS даёт возможность изменить любой элемент внешнего облика.

Стили можно присоединить тремя методами. Внешний документ соединяется с HTML-документом через метку link. Внутренние стили располагаются в метке style. Inline стили записываются в параметре элемента.

Каскадность подразумевает приоритет применения директив. Инлайновые стили обладают максимальный вес. Внутренние стили перекрывают отдельные. Браузер задействует максимально конкретное инструкцию к каждому элементу.

CSS контролирует всеми визуальными параметрами. Специалисты задают цвета заднего плана и текста. Стили изменяют размеры, отступы и рамки элементов. Современный Вулкан казино применяет анимации и переходы для формирования динамических результатов.

Селекторы, свойства и значения в CSS

Правило CSS формируется из трёх компонентов. Селектор определяет элемент для стилизования. Свойство определяет характеристику стилизации. Значение определяет конкретный значение.

Селекторы определяют компоненты по разнообразным критериям. Селектор элемента назначает стили ко всем компонентам заданного типа. Селектор класса работает с параметром class. Селектор идентификатора выбирает индивидуальный тег по свойству id.

Составные селекторы генерируют более конкретные директивы. Селектор потомка выбирает вложенные компоненты. Селектор непосредственного тега работает только с прямыми наследниками. Псевдоклассы назначают стили при заданных состояниях.

Свойства задают различные стороны дизайна. Атрибуты color и background-color регулируют цветовой палитрой. Атрибуты width и height задают габариты. Атрибуты margin и padding контролируют интервалы.

Значения указываются в разнообразных форматах. Оттенки определяются в шестнадцатеричном виде, RGB или наименованиями. Размеры измеряются в пикселях, процентах или пропорциональных мерах. Грамотное задействование селекторов способствует Вулкан продуктивно управлять стилизацией совокупности тегов.

Взаимодействие с тонами, шрифтами и полями

Цветовое оформление создаёт визуальную атмосферу страницы. Свойство color модифицирует тон текста. Параметр background-color задаёт подложку блока. Цвета записываются несколькими методами: именами, шестнадцатеричными записями или значениями RGB.

Шестнадцатеричный тип стартует с символа хеша. Код формируется из шести символов, обозначающих красный, зелёный и синий составляющие. Формат RGB использует цифровые параметры от 0 до 255 для каждого цвета. Вид RGBA добавляет параметр прозрачности.

Оформление текста воздействует на удобочитаемость контента. Свойство font-family устанавливает гарнитуру шрифта. Параметр font-size устанавливает размер символов. Свойство font-weight контролирует толщину шрифта. Атрибут line-height задаёт межстрочный промежуток.

Стандартные шрифты имеются на всех аппаратах. Онлайн-шрифты подгружаются с внешних хостов. Ресурс Google Fonts обеспечивает безвозмездную библиотеку гарнитур. Программисты указывают несколько шрифтов в порядке важности.

Поля формируют место вокруг компонентов. Атрибут margin создаёт наружные поля между блоками. Свойство padding генерирует внутренние интервалы от рамок до наполнения. Отступы можно задавать для каждой грани отдельно или одним значением сразу для всех граней. Грамотное применение казино Вулкан усиливает визуальную организацию и восприятие контента.

Блочная модель и позиционирование блоков

Блочная модель характеризует организацию каждого HTML-элемента. Модель складывается из четырёх зон: наполнения, внутреннего поля, обводки и внешнего интервала. Осознание этой принципа важно для точного регулирования габаритами.

Зона контента содержит текст и изображения. Внутренний отступ padding создаёт место между контентом и границей. Граница border обрамляет компонент отображаемой полосой. Наружный поле margin формирует расстояние до соседних блоков.

Параметр box-sizing меняет вычисление размеров. Значение content-box включает только наполнение. Параметр border-box вмещает padding и border в общую размер.

Атрибут display определяет тип представления. Блочные элементы занимают всю свободную ширину. Строчные блоки располагаются в одной строке. Вариант inline-block совмещает свойства обоих типов.

Параметр position контролирует позиционированием. Параметр relative перемещает компонент относительно первоначального места. Absolute размещает компонент относительно родительского контейнера. Новейший Вулкан казино задействует Flexbox и Grid для построения комплексных структур.

Отзывчивая разработка для разных устройств

Отзывчивая верстка предоставляет корректное визуализацию веб-ресурса на всех мониторах. Посетители посещают на веб-страницы с десктопов, планшетов и смартфонов. Оформление должен настраиваться под габарит экрана самостоятельно.

Медиазапросы задействуют стили в зависимости от характеристик аппарата. Инструкция @media проверяет ширину дисплея и другие свойства. Разработчики генерируют отдельные коллекции стилей для разнообразных промежутков величин.

Принцип mobile-first открывает разработку с варианта для мобильных устройств. Базовые стили описывают оформление для небольших экранов. Медиазапросы добавляют расширения для больших экранов.

Гибкие сетки используют относительные меры расчёта. Ширина контейнеров определяется в процентах вместо постоянных пикселей. Flexbox и Grid создают адаптивные компоновки без трудных расчётов.

Картинки требуют особого учёта при оптимизации. Свойство max-width со параметром 100% исключает выступание иллюстраций за края контейнера. Атрибут srcset скачивает изображения различного качества. Корректная реализация казино Вулкан повышает пользовательский опыт на всех типах платформ.

Распространённые промахи стартующих при разработке с HTML и CSS

Стартующие специалисты совершают стандартные ошибки при создании сайтов. Понимание частых ошибок способствует предотвратить их в личных разработках. Исправление ошибок на ранних стадиях сберегает время и повышает качество кода.

Главные ошибки при взаимодействии с структурой и стилями:

  • Открытые теги нарушают архитектуру файла и приводят к некорректному отображению
  • Задействование старых меток вместо актуальных семантических тегов
  • Недостаток описательного текста для изображений уменьшает доступность контента
  • Инлайновые стили в HTML затрудняют сопровождение и модификацию дизайна
  • Неправильная иерархия компонентов порождает ошибки в архитектуре
  • Чрезмерное использование идентификаторов вместо классов ограничивает повторное задействование стилей

Недочёты с CSS также встречаются регулярно. Новички упускают указывать величины измерения для цифровых величин. Чрезмерно точные селекторы осложняют изменение стилей. Отсутствие обнуления стилей обозревателя создаёт различия в отображении на разных устройствах.

Пренебрежение кроссбраузерной совместимости ведёт к проблемам. Сайт может идеально выглядеть в одном браузере и неправильно в втором. Верификация кода посредством специализированные сервисы находит синтаксические промахи. Регулярная верификация помогает Вулкан поддерживать отличное уровень программирования и согласованность стандартам.

Artículos relacionados

Respuestas